matrocliny

[ ma-truh-klahy-nee, mey- ]

noun

Genetics.
  1. inheritance in which the traits of the offspring are derived primarily from the maternal parent ( patrocliny ).

51Թ History and Origins

Origin of matrocliny1

1915–20; matro- (variant of matri- with -o- ) + -clin- (< Greek ī́Ա𾱲 to bend, lean, or extracted from incline; cline ) + -y 3
